Bei Dir War Es Immer So Schön- Album Overview
"Bei Dir War Es Immer So Schön," released in 1967, is a pivotal album by the German actress and singer Hildegard Knef. This album showcases Knef's unique blend of chanson, jazz, and pop, reflecting her multifaceted talent as an artist. Known for her deep, smoky voice and poignant lyrics, Knef's music often draws on personal experiences and the complexities of love and life. The album was released under the Polydor label, a significant platform in the 1960s for many artists in Europe. The production of the album involved notable collaborators, including renowned composers and arrangers who helped shape its distinctive sound. The title track, "Bei Dir War Es Immer So Schön," stands out as a classic and has become synonymous with Knef's legacy, encapsulating the bittersweet essence of nostalgia and longing. The album includes a variety of tracks that highlight her lyrical prowess, with themes ranging from love to existential reflection. Knef's ability to convey emotion through her music resonated deeply with listeners during a time of social change in Germany. The album not only solidified her status in the music industry but also contributed to the cultural landscape of the time, as it echoed the sentiments of a generation navigating the complexities of modern life.
